Descriptions
- Description AT hook motif DNA-binding family protein
- Computational description AT hook motif DNA-binding family protein; FUNCTIONS IN: DNA binding; EXPRESSED IN: 14 plant structures; EXPRESSED DURING: 4 anthesis, F mature embryo stage, petal differentiation and expansion stage, E expanded cotyledon stage, D bilateral stage; CONTAINS InterPro DOMAIN/s: Protein of unknown function DUF296 (InterPro:IPR005175), AT hook, DNA-binding motif (InterPro:IPR017956); BEST Arabidopsis thaliana protein match is: AT-hook motif nuclear-localized protein 1 (TAIR:AT4G12080.1); Has 918 Blast hits to 910 proteins in 100 species: Archae - 0; Bacteria - 92; Metazoa - 24; Fungi - 29; Plants - 756; Viruses - 8; Other Eukaryotes - 9 (source: NCBI BLink).
